电信运营商OracleOracle审计

oracle审计功能有没有办法增加业务标识?

类似oracle的审计功能,我有没有办法在审计的基础上加我自己的一些业务标识,比如原本可以记录某条记录的修改情况,我想增加自己的业务标识,比如xxx账号进行操作之类的,有可行性或者有类似的产品么?

参与16

5同行回答

y18511664518y18511664518技术总监长城超云
有专门的硬件,数据库审计,可以去看看,数据库层次实现起来比较繁琐复杂,而且对性能影响非常大,不建议。显示全部

有专门的硬件,数据库审计,可以去看看,数据库层次实现起来比较繁琐复杂,而且对性能影响非常大,不建议。

收起
金融其它 · 2018-03-26
匿名用户匿名用户
增加业务标识,需要人工增加想审计谁谁干了什么,设计一个表,然后用触发器存储过程,做一个完整的逻辑,只要XX用户等了,执行了delete,就触发插入一条记录信息显示全部

增加业务标识,需要人工增加
想审计谁谁干了什么,设计一个表,然后用触发器存储过程,做一个完整的逻辑,只要XX用户等了,执行了delete,就触发插入一条记录信息

收起
互联网服务 · 2018-03-23
浏览1921
  • 这个方案主要是针对一些老旧的项目,编码规范和系统架构都不规范并且很难追索,所以只有在数据库上动脑筋,如果新项目直接通过程序底层就可以统一实现了。 触发器方案一开始就考虑了,我并不只是想记录谁干了什么,还要包括操作的所有数据的具体内容,比如xxx用户修改了100条记录,还需要能记录这100条记录修改前和修改后每个字段的内容,这样要每个期望监控表上都建触发器,但是这样带来的改造和维护量还是太大
    2018-03-23
xiaopeng91xiaopeng91数据库运维工程师陕西~~~
买买买有专业的审计设备,全程录屏的也有,就看你们舍得钱不显示全部

买买买
有专业的审计设备,全程录屏的也有,就看你们舍得钱不

收起
互联网服务 · 2018-03-29
浏览1855
AcdanteAcdante技术总监SHFY
岳兄所言极是。你的需求采用触发器或者在数据库层面去实现会给原有业务造成很大的影响,也不建议这样去做。现在有很多硬件软件产品可以满足你的需求。如数据库防火墙,数据库审计等等。具体的厂家就不多说了,需要可以私信。...显示全部

岳兄所言极是。
你的需求采用触发器或者在数据库层面去实现会给原有业务造成很大的影响,也不建议这样去做。
现在有很多硬件软件产品可以满足你的需求。如数据库防火墙,数据库审计等等。具体的厂家就不多说了,需要可以私信。

收起
互联网服务 · 2018-03-28
浏览1783
topmaastopmaas软件开发工程师qq
[此回答已删除]
浏览1526

提问者

青衣老刀
系统分析师亿阳信通
擅长领域: 数据库服务器信创中间件

相关问题

相关资料

相关文章

问题状态

  • 发布时间:2018-03-23
  • 关注会员:7 人
  • 问题浏览:3319
  • 最近回答:2018-03-29
  • X社区推广